Output 3a3172c6f320a7ab2dd8f356d56e00f66691a83fa41f68d6201c45f81d73d42a:1

value
114306929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ba4f602474cbfa1e64a27c4231ed4d43fc2be161 OP_EQUAL
address
3Jg8hLMg5ALAVH6dSGLcCkKnHAy3EQZo5u
transaction
3a3172c6f320a7ab2dd8f356d56e00f66691a83fa41f68d6201c45f81d73d42a
confirmations
324870
spent
true